Olympus FE-45 vs Pentax K100D Overview

Its time to look a little more in depth at the Olympus FE-45 versus Pentax K100D, one is a Small Sensor Compact and the other is a Entry-Level DSLR by rivals Olympus and Pentax. There is a significant difference among the image resolutions of the FE-45 (10MP) and K100D (6MP) and the FE-45 (1/2.3") and K100D (APS-C) feature totally different sensor sizes.

Olympus FE-45 vs Pentax K100D Physical Comparison

When you are going to travel with your camera regularly, you need to take into account its weight and measurements. The Olympus FE-45 enjoys outside measurements of 94mm x 62mm x 23mm (3.7" x 2.4" x 0.9") and a weight of 142 grams (0.31 lbs) whilst the Pentax K100D has proportions of 129mm x 93mm x 70mm (5.1" x 3.7" x 2.8") along with a weight of 660 grams (1.46 lbs).

Olympus FE-45 vs Pentax K100D Sensor Comparison

In many cases, it is very hard to see the gap in sensor dimensions just by checking out specifications. The pic here might offer you a better sense of the sensor measurements in the FE-45 and K100D.

To sum up, both cameras have got different resolutions and different sensor dimensions. The FE-45 featuring a smaller sensor will make achieving bokeh more difficult and the Olympus FE-45 will provide greater detail having its extra 4MP. Greater resolution can also make it easier to crop pics much more aggressively. The fresher FE-45 will have an advantage when it comes to sensor tech.
